    This is the first time I have seen Elizabeth Cotten playing, it's simply amazing. I knew she played a right hand strung guitar upside down because I heard Ramblin' Jack Elliot talk about it. He tells the story about how, when she was a young girl, she wasn't allowed to play guitar. So when the house was empty she used to sneak a go on her brothers guitar which was right handed but she was left handed. So she learned to play a right handed guitar in the left hand position.If you are a guitarist (and/or gave her a thumbs down) give it a try.

    There's a land that is fairer than day
    And by faith we can see it afar
    For the Father waits over the way
    To prepare us a dwelling place there
    In the sweet by and by
    We shall meet on that beautiful shore
    In the sweet by and by
    We shall meet on that beautiful shore
    We shall sing on that beautiful shore
    The melodious songs of the blessed
    And our spirits shall sorrow no more
    Not a sigh for the blessing of rest
    In the sweet by and by
    We shall meet on that beautiful shore
    In the sweet by and by
    We shall meet on that beautiful shore
    To our bountiful Father above
    We will offer our tribute of praise
    For the glorious gift of His love
    And the blessings that hallow our days
    In the sweet by and by
    We shall meet on that beautiful shore
    In the sweet by and by
    We shall meet on that beautiful shore
    Written by:
    Sanford F. Bennett, 1868
